Description

A new merchant, Jimmy Morgan, has set up shop at the riverboat landing. He sells items imported from Point Lookout. This is mainly useful for saving yourself a trip down the river to purchase weapons unique to that area to use for repairs. It also seemed appropriate for an enterprising trader to establish himself on the dock for trading with travelers.

Jimmy will wander in a small area (I didn't want him falling in the water), sit in his chair from time to time, and engage in standard conversation. There is no new dialog or story. He is so eager for business, you'll never catch him sleeping (I didn't think it was necessary to set up a sleep cycle for such a minor character -- he probably catches a nap when you're not around). I flagged him as Essential so that he couldn't fall prey to the mirelurks in the area, so leave the nice trader alone.

I designed this mod to be minimally intrusive. It does not replace or alter existing content, except for the small amount of space on the dock that the vendor and his table and chair occupy. I placed Jimmy so that it looks as if he owns the 3 metal boxes that already existed in his little corner, but they are unmodified and you can still loot them. I assigned him a low repair skill and the "small" merchant cash pool (equivalent to a bartender's) so as not to unbalance the game -- beyond saving the trip to Point Lookout for supplies of course. If you want a crackerjack repairman or a major source of caps, there are other mods for that. This mod just does one thing.

Requirements

Point Lookout expansion.

Installation

Copy the ESP file into your game's Data folder.

Uninstall

Delete the ESP file from your game's Data folder.

Compatibility

This mod does not replace or alter existing content. There will be spatial conflicts if you have another mod installed that places objects on that corner of the dock.

Known Issues or Bugs

Jimmy uses the standard wasteland scavenger dialog, so he will sometimes utter the line about preferring to sell to you than having to haul his goods back to Megaton.
